Comparison of Nike G.T. Cut 4 and Competitor Models
Feature/Model | Nike G.T. Cut 4 | Nike Air Zoom G.T. Cut | Adidas Dame 7 | Puma Clyde All-Pro |
---|---|---|---|---|
Traction | Excellent indoor; moderate outdoor | Good indoor; average outdoor | Average indoor; good outdoor | Excellent indoor and outdoor |
Cushioning | Triple-layered cushioning | Dual-layer cushioning | Bounce cushioning | ProFoam cushioning |
Weight | 12 oz | 11 oz | 13 oz | 11.5 oz |
Upper Material | Breathable mesh | Engineered mesh | Synthetic leather | Woven textile |
Price | $130 | $120 | $110 | $130 |
Design and Aesthetics
The Nike G.T. Cut 4 showcases a modern design with sleek lines and a variety of colorways that appeal to players and sneaker enthusiasts alike. The upper is crafted from a breathable mesh that not only enhances airflow but also provides a snug fit. This combination ensures that players remain cool during intense game sessions while maintaining comfort.
Performance Analysis
Traction
The G.T. Cut 4 features an advanced outsole designed for superior grip on indoor courts. The unique traction pattern allows for quick cuts and changes in direction, essential for basketball performance. However, when taken outdoors, some users have reported a decrease in grip, particularly on dusty surfaces.
Cushioning System
Nike has incorporated a triple-layer cushioning system in the G.T. Cut 4. This setup includes a combination of Zoom Air units and foam layers, providing responsive cushioning that adapts to various playing styles. Players have noted significant comfort during extended play, reducing fatigue and enhancing overall performance.
Fit and Comfort
The shoe’s fit is another highlight. With a secure lockdown mechanism and padded collar, players experience a snug yet comfortable fit. The breathable material allows for moisture control, reducing the chances of blisters or discomfort during high-energy games.
Comparison of Technical Features
Feature | Nike G.T. Cut 4 | Nike Air Zoom G.T. Cut | Adidas Dame 7 | Puma Clyde All-Pro |
---|---|---|---|---|
Traction Type | Multi-directional | Flat and angular | Herringbone | Radial traction |
Weight Distribution | Balanced | Lightweight | Heavier | Lightweight |
Ankle Support | Moderate | High | Low | Moderate |
Breathability | High | Moderate | High | Moderate |
Price Point | $130 | $120 | $110 | $130 |
